Cushing syndrome is caused by prolonged exposure to high circulating levels of cortisol. The most common cause of cushingoid features is iatrogenic corticosteroid use, while some herbal preparations can also increase circulating corticosteroid levels leading to Cushing syndrome. WebJan 31, 2024 · Cushing syndrome (CS), a rare disorder of the adrenal gland, is even more challenging to detect in pregnant individuals. 1 Even in normal pregnancies, plasma and urinary free cortisol can be 2 to 3 times their normal levels. 1 High levels of cortisol can lead to maternal hypertension, preeclampsia, diabetes, cardiac failure, and even death. The diagnostic … WebNov 26, 2024 · The first test is a saliva cortisol test that measures midnight salivary cortisol samples. One of the early indicators of Cushing’s syndrome is the loss of the normal circadian variation of cortisol secretion. The second test is a 24-hour urine cortisol test.
